Courances to Orléans - Language, Currency, Distance, How to Reach, Expenses, Best time to go, What to Eat, Where to Go, FAQ

Courances is a commune in the Seine-et-Marne department in the Île-de-France region in north-central France. Orléans is a city in north-central France, the capital of the Centre-Val de Loire region and of the Loiret department.

The distance between Courances and Orléans is approximately 100 kilometers (62 miles).

How to Reach

There are several ways to reach Orléans from Courances, including by car, train, or bus.

  • By car: The drive from Courances to Orléans takes approximately 1 hour and 30 minutes.
  • By train: There is a direct train line between Courances and Orléans, with trains departing every hour. The journey takes approximately 1 hour and 15 minutes.
  • By bus: There are several bus lines that run between Courances and Orléans, with buses departing every 2 hours. The journey takes approximately 2 hours and 30 minutes.
